Transaction 75ebbf63d80b51847215003f5b126cbcf3a43cf86849500cf17cc9c8f49099de

2 Input
2 Outputs
  • 75ebbf63d80b51847215003f5b126cbcf3a43cf86849500cf17cc9c8f49099de:0
  • value  1318
    address  15auupRcp8qdhua6rWaiEvv8kMofcdUGPw
  • 75ebbf63d80b51847215003f5b126cbcf3a43cf86849500cf17cc9c8f49099de:1
  • value  218339
    address  14D6pR26Uw2BBAvRcJ9pypSZvTA59J25qY